Profile

A youth exponent of Sevilla, Luis Alberto featured largely for the club’s B & C sides in the lower divisions, making just 9 first-team appearances. He spent the 2012-13 season on loan at Barcelona, where he scored 11 goals in 38 appearances for the reserves before completing a permanent move to Liverpool in 2013.

However, Alberto’s career in English football failed to take off and he was frozen out of the set-up after making just 12 appearances in his debut season at Anfield. The 28-year-old excelled on loan at Malaga and Deportivo La Coruna in the La Liga over the next two seasons before Italian outfit Lazio came calling for his services in 2016.

Alberto has since established himself as one of the most effective playmakers in Italy, accumulating an impressive tally of 27 goals and 44 assists in 142 appearances across all competitions. The Spaniard was instrumental as Simone Ingazhi’s side finished 4th in the Serie A last season and qualified for the Champions League.
